1 <br /> TABLE 4 <br />' ANALYTICAL RESULTS OF GROUNDWATER SAMPLES <br /> Hess-DuBois Cleaners <br /> 348 West Harding Way, Stockton, Callrornia <br /> Sample I.D./ TPH as' StoddardBenzene Toluene Ethyl- <br /> Date Xylenes Solvent benzene <br />' MW-1111-4-93 660 3.4 ND 4.3 3.9 <br /> MW-116-22-94 190 ND ND ND ND <br /> MW-119-27-94 160 ND ND ND ND <br />' MW-2111-4-93 880 ND ND 4.3 6.2 <br /> MW-216-22-94 670 ND ND ND ND <br />' MW-219-27-94 600 ND ND ND ND <br /> MW-3/11-4-93 41,000 29 ND 120 610 <br /> tMW-316-22-94 2,800 ND ND 17 1.5 <br /> MW-319-27-94 880 1.2 ND 15 2.4 <br /> fcg/L=parts per Ulm <br /> - 5.0 CONCLUSIONS & RECOMMENDATIONS <br /> 5.1 Groundwater Flow Direction and Gradient <br />' Since January 1994, the groundwater flow direction and gradient have remained between <br /> N 5 ° E and N 430 W; the gradient has averaged approximately 0.023 ft/ft. Both these <br /> calculations are consistent with regional and local trends. The flow direction continues to <br />' be north-northwest. <br /> 5.2 Petroleum Hydrocarbon Impacted Soil <br />' Petroleum hydrocarbon impacted soil remains in the vicinity of MW-3. The extent of the <br /> impacted soil has not been determined. Additional assessment will be necessary to <br />' determine the extent of impacted soil and to design an appropriate remediation system. <br />' 5.3 Petroleum Hydrocarbon Impacted Groundwater <br /> Concentrations of TPH as Stoddard Solvent has decreased in all three monitoring wells from <br /> ' November 1993 to September 1994. Concentrations of BTE&X has not been detected in <br /> MW-1 and MW-2 since the first sampling event in November 1993. Very Iow concentrations <br /> of Benzene, Ethylbenzene and Xylenes were still detected in MW-3. In the third quarter, <br /> xn..a.e.:awnak" <br /> 1 <br />
